Paint Matching and Factory Finish Restoration for Hummer Vehicles
Hummer colors are distinct. Military Green, Bright White, Pewter Gray, and custom fleet colors require precise spectral matching. ACG uses computerized paint matching equipment calibrated to Hummer factory specifications. Before any panel leaves our spray booth, we validate color match under natural light, fluorescent light, and shade to ensure the repair is invisible.
Most Hummer vehicles use polyurethane clear coat systems that demand exact cure times, application pressure, and humidity control. Our Covina spray booth maintains factory environmental standards. We sand damaged areas to bare substrate, apply Hummer-approved primers and base coats, and finish with clear coat that matches original gloss and texture. Panel blending extends refinishing into adjacent undamaged areas to eliminate color gradients.
Hummer H2 and H3 models frequently appear in commercial fleets where finish durability matters. Our refinishing process includes final buffing, ceramic coat application if requested, and inspection under high-intensity lighting before the vehicle is released.
OEM Parts and Insurance Coordination
Insurance companies often push aftermarket parts to reduce claim payouts. ACG uses only OEM Hummer parts, period. OEM parts guarantee fitment, function, and longevity. They carry the Hummer factory warranty and preserve your vehicle’s resale value. Aftermarket bumpers, fenders, and trim may fit loosely, discolor over time, or cause alignment issues that surface months after repair.
